Abdul Hameed Shoman Foundation Research Support Fund (Jordan)

Deadline: 19 August 2025

Applicants are now invited to submit applications for the Abdul Hameed Shoman Foundation Research Support Fund to encourage scientific research contributions within Higher Education and Scientific Institutions as well as collaborative research between international and national research centers.

This funding went to 150 research projects from 23 Jordanian universities and institutions, resulting in 182 scientific papers being published in peer-reviewed journals in the fields of medical and health sciences, engineering sciences, environmental and agricultural sciences, basic sciences, social and economic sciences and humanities, information technology and the digital economy.

The fund aims to support research that uses a systematic analysis of society’s problems, basic needs, and economic, social, educational, cultural, environmental, and health aspirations to bring scientific and technical institutions closer to the surrounding communities, contributes to comprehensive development strategies, and facilitates Jordanian society’s communication with advanced societies.

The Abdul Hameed Shoman Fund also aims to assist researchers in gaining access to new areas of science and experience, as well as to highlight the role of research centers and universities as platforms for disseminating knowledge, stimulating innovation, and finding solutions to local challenges in order to ensure a sustainable and promising future.

Objectives

  • Support applied scientific research of added value, and leading to innovative solutions.
  • Encourage participation in scientific research at higher education institutions and cooperation with national and international research centers.
  • Direct researchers to address topics that meet the needs of the Jordanian society and contribute to tackling national and international challenges.

Fields

  • Medical and health sciences
  • Basic sciences
  • Engineering sciences
  • Social & economic sciences and humanities
  • Agricultural and environmental sciences
  • Telecommunications, information technology and digital economy

Funding Information

  • The funding cap will be 20,000 JOD, including research compensation and publication costs.
  • The researchers’ reward shall not exceed 30% of the project’s budget, up to JOD 2,000 if the research is to be implemented within 12 months, and up to JOD 4,000 if the research is to take longer than 12 months.

Eligibility Criteria

  • To hold a PhD degree;
  • To be a resident in Jordan – regardless of his/her nationality;
  • To belong to a research or academic institution or center in Jordan.
  • To be among the national priorities of scientific research;
  • To be in line with AHSF objectives and orientations regarding scientific research support.
  • To be applicable and of added value.
  • Master/PhD thesis or graduation project will not be eligible.
  • The principal investigator (Applicant) shall be a resident of Jordan – regardless of his/her nationality.
  • The principal investigator (Applicant) shall be working for an academic or research institution in Jordan.
  • The principal investigator (Applicant) shall hold a PhD degree.
  • The researcher(s) shall have sufficient experience to complete the project.
  • The proposal shall be among the national priorities of scientific research.
  • The proposal shall be in line with AHSF objectives, orientations and ethics regarding scientific research support.
  • The submitted proposal shall be Applicable and of added value.
  • The research entity shall provide no less than 30% of the total amount required for the research implementation as a contribution to the project (in cash or in kind).

Application Requirements

  • Application shall be made at the system, and a researcher shall fill the required fields as shown in the video, including:
    • Information on the lead researcher and assistant researchers.
    • A summary of the research proposal.
    • An introduction to the research proposal.
    • The latest and most significant publication made in the research topic.
    • The method used in the research.
    • References.
    • Time plan.
    • Objectives and activities.
    • Proposed budget in details.
  • Upon starting to fill an application, please take the following into consideration:
    • All required fields of personal information, academic qualifications and achievements must be filled.
    • The project commencement date shall be 01.01.2026.
    • The project shall be split into stages associated with specific objectives, activities and timeframe.
    • Make sure all of the required attachments are uploaded and use the required forms to fill some of them at the system, which are:
      • A copy of ID card or passport
      • CV
      • PhD certificate
      • Research center’s registration certificate
      • Other attachments (if required)
